Chief Minister Yogi Adityanath on Thursday directed officers to call and disgrace folks concerned in eve-teasing and harassment of girls by placing up posters carrying their names and images in public locations.

“The Chief Minister has directed that posters of criminals involved in molesting women, girls and children, misbehaviour and sexual harassment cases be displayed on road intersections and public places, along with the names of those aiding such criminals, so that people come to know about them,” an announcement issued by the federal government stated.

The directives have been issued after the CM took cognizance of an incident that happened in Kanpur on Thursday morning when a 21-year-old Dalit girl was allegedly assaulted by two youths who have been stalking her. The two have been later arrested and booked for try and homicide, molestation and felony intimidation. The duo was additionally charged underneath sections of the SC/ST (Prevention of Atrocities) Act.

The assertion issued by the federal government additionally stated that Adityanath directed police in each district to maintain working for girls security just like the anti-Romeo squads, “which have shown great results and discouraged eve-teasers”. Moreover, in case of an incident of crime towards girls in an space, the beat in-charge, the police outpost in-charge, the police station in-charge and the circle officer involved can be held accountable, it added.

Also, instructions have been that “such criminals be punished by women police personnel to send a strong message,” the assertion learn.

Later, the state Home Department stated that in accordance with the CM’s instructions, anti-Romeo squads will likely be additional strengthened. “To put a stop on incidents of molestation and eve-teasing, the anti-Romeo squads are active in every district. In a meeting with the home and police department officials, Additional Chief Secretary (Home) Awanish Kumar Awasthi said that by taking strict and effective action, a better image of the police will be presented so that women can have an increased faith in the department,” learn the assertion.

It additionally stated that anti-Romeo squads “checked” greater than 83 lakh folks in over 35 lakh faculties, schools and public locations, like markets, malls and parks. Based on the “checking”, circumstances have been registered towards 7,351 folks and 11,564 have been arrested, whereas greater than 35 lakh folks have been let off after correct warning.

Speaking to The Indian Express, DGP Hitesh Chandra Awasthy refused to touch upon the course of placing of posters of these committing crime towards girls, saying that he was but to obtain an official order. “I have not yet received any such communication, and once we get it, we will act on it accordingly. We have, however, re-issued directions that we have to be very careful about such crimes taking place and have to take strong action against such people. A similar order was issued by me around 20-25 days ago,” the DGP stated.

Among a bunch of instructions issued by the DGP included rapid registering of FIRs and making arrests in reference to crimes towards girls, common patrolling in delicate areas, use of body-worn cameras, set up of CCTV cameras in public locations, faculties, malls and parks, criticism bins in ladies schools, escorting girl to their vacation spot within the night time amongst others.

When requested that the “name and shame” motion can be taken towards the 2 kids who have been arrested on Thursday for alleged assault on a university woman, Kanpur DIG Preetinder Singh stated that placing up posters of the offender in such crimes is required when police usually are not capable of finding and arrest them. “The important thing in such cases is taking strict action against such people. In this particular case, we arrested the accused within two hours of the crime taking place. As far as putting up posters is concerned, we will be doing so only in cases in which the accused is absconding,” Singh added.
